JUSTIN M. KLEIN
![]()
Justin focuses his practice in the areas of franchise law, commercial
litigation, and general business law. He has served as legal counsel to
businesses, both privately held and public, and individuals, in
transactions, litigation, arbitration and mediation throughout the United
States and internationally. Justin also counsels and consults with
businesses on methods of expansion and development including franchising,
licensing, formation of strategic partnerships and other methods of
distribution.
Justin is a zealous advocate for his clients, no matter how large or small, but understands and appreciates the art of negotiation and the benefits of resolving cases before trial. Justin has excelled at representing single and multi-unit franchisees of many prominent franchise systems throughout the United States and internationally in all aspects of their franchise relationship from acquisition, to development, to litigation. Justin has served as counsel to hundreds of franchisees in litigation, arbitration and mediation throughout the United States and abroad; from single dealer termination matters to complex class actions. Justin also works with franchisees in various systems and assists in the formation of independent franchisee associations intended to benefit or for the protection of franchisees throughout the particular franchise system.
He lectures frequently on franchise and other business law issues and is
often quoted in national media in regards to franchise issues. Justin has
also been designated to speak on behalf of the New Jersey Economic
Development Authority Entrepreneurial Training Institute as an expert on
franchising.
In 2009, for the third consecutive year, Justin was honored as a Franchise Times Legal Eagle for being considered by his peers and clients to be one of the top franchise attorneys in North America. Justin is a member the American Bar Association (Franchise Section, Litigation Section), International Franchise Association, the New York Bar Association, the New Jersey Bar Association, the Association of the Trial Lawyers of America and the American Franchisee Association. Justin is admitted to practice in the state and federal courts of New Jersey and New York, the District of Colorado, the District of Wisconsin, the Eastern District of Michigan and has handled matters throughout the United States, Europe and Canada.
